AGE 4 was held in Bayu Beach, Port Dickson on 3 February 2007 to 4 February 2007. I was there as part of the organizing committee, photographer and also as part of the LTP community.


What is AGE 4 and LTP, you ask?
LTP is a group of community that “graduate” from a Leadership Training Programme (there’s where the word LTP came from) facilitated by D’Jungle People. LTP community gives back to the community as a group by helping out or visiting the orphanage, old folks home, SPCA and etc.
AGE 4 is the acronym for for Annual Gathering Event and the 4 means this is the forth gathering. This gathering is not only the gathering of the LTP community and D’Jungle People but also open to others as well - friends of LTP members.
This year, AGE 4 is held as a telematch as part of one group competing with one another and a dinner with a time of sharing of their memorable moments.
Before the telematch, a 30 minutes ice-breaking is conducted by Khim, Marvin and Alicia.

The participants of AGE 4 is grouped to 5 groups and each group would need to complete all 6 games.
